Frequently Asked Questions About Title Loans in Deltona, FL

Can a 200,000-mile car still get a loan in Deltona?

Yes. Our Deltona data is full of high-mileage vehicles, several over 200,000 miles, that still funded. What matters is whether the vehicle has genuine resale value and runs reliably, and makes like Toyota and Honda hold value well even at high mileage.

A very high-mileage vehicle appraises toward the lower end of the range, often a few hundred to a couple thousand dollars. Bring records of major services such as timing belt, transmission, and recent repairs, since they distinguish a well-kept car from a worn one and can support a better number.

What decides my loan amount in Deltona, and why isn’t a newer car always worth more? 

It is worth understanding that the loan size rests on two things, not just the car. We review your ability to repay from documented income, and we appraise the vehicle, where the number tracks resale demand, condition, mileage, make, model, and year rather than model year alone. That explains why a 2015 Jeep Wrangler with 62,000 miles funded at $9,928, above newer sedans in the same Deltona sample, since Wranglers depreciate slowly and hold strong resale value. Florida’s lending rules apply on top. If your household has more than one vehicle, we can quote against each so you can see which supports the loan you need and which you can most afford to pledge.

My car is my only way to commute to Orlando. What is at stake if I default?

Deltona is largely a bedroom community with limited transit, so your vehicle is often essential, and it is also the collateral. If the loan defaults and the car is repossessed, you can lose both the vehicle and the commute you depend on to keep earning.

So the decision should rest on affordability, not just approval. Make sure the 30-day payment, or a planned extension, fits even in a tight month, and check lower-cost options such as a credit union small-dollar loan or a payment plan first. If a title loan is still right, size it conservatively and keep comprehensive insurance on the car.
